Germany: Agrar wants to expand

After a good start to the year with new framework agreements and orders at the trade fairs Fruit Logistica and BioFach, KTG Agrar determined its expansion forecast for the medium term: the company aims to expand the turnover of its trading company to more than 300 million Euro, reports the German website Proplanta.de.

All three sectors, agriculture, food and energy, will contribute to the expansion. The EBIT margin will be stable at more than twelve percent. Consistent with this the agriculture company is expecting an operative result of more then 36 million Euro.

"We have invested a lot in crop lands, bio gas plants and food production since 2012 to create economical benefits and not be dependent on the fluctuation in the agricultural exchange market. This investment phase, where we have formed a lot of hidden reserves, is now almost completed and would not have been possible without the planning security of the loan finance," said Siegfried Hofreiter, CEO of KTG Agrar SE. "We will use our potential to the fullest, bring in the harvest and reduce our debts graduate in the years to come."
